Mission Statement

PACT for Animals is a national nonprofit that provides free, background checked foster services. PACT gives peace of mind to children, veterans and adults in acute care at local hospitals, and soldiers on deployment, by placing their pets in temporary foster homes until their owners can be reunited with the companion animals they love.

Description

Every year thousands of companion animals are surrendered into animal shelters due to temporary crises. By providing access to temporary foster homes for animals when their human companions are temporarily unable to care for them, PACT helps reduce the number of animals surrendered to animal shelters. PACT saves the lives of beloved companion animals at risk of abandonment and gives peace of mind to their human companions until they can be safely reunited. We are the ONLY active non-profit organization in the country providing this free, essential service in the animal welfare community.

PACT's offers a Military Foster Program and a Hospital Foster Program. These programs keep people and their companion animals together with every successful crisis rescue, foster placement, and joyful reunion.

All PACT Programs are FREE! PACT’s Foster Program Managers carefully screen every case, ensuring that both foster families and animals are compatible. Foster families are in constant contact with the military/hospitalized owners providing regular updates, including photos, messages and videos of their beloved pets.
